Emerson EV-406N VCR With A SYSCON Problem

(A.K.A. Daewoo DV-K406N)

Symptom: when 'stop' is pressed, the tape is not wound back into the cassette. This makes it impossible to rewind the tape at full speed and causes an emergency shutdown when attempted. However, the tape winds back in properly when ejecting. The other controls work properly as well.

The mode encoder switch has been cleaned and several poor capacitors in the power supply have been replaced, but the problem still persists. What else could it be?

Fixed! The capstan belt was slipping. A tighter belt has allowed it to rewind the tapes that were previously triggering an emergency shutdown.
